Xylo raised £2.8 million in a funding round supported by angel investors affiliated with DeepMind and Gensyn. The investment underscores strong confidence from prominent AI labs in Xylo’s technology and gives the startup capital to scale operations and product development. Xylo will likely use the funds to hire key personnel, advance its product roadmap, and may pursue a follow‑on Series A round later this year. Xylo’s £2.8m raise, backed by angels from DeepMind and Gensyn, reflects continued investor confidence in UK‑based AI startups. The round provides the company with resources to expand its team and accelerate product development, while also signaling that alumni from leading AI labs remain active as early‑stage supporters. Such angel‑led rounds often precede larger institutional funding rounds as startups mature.
